The Prompt structuring behind the skill

Do you want to reverse engineer the skill yourself or use it as a prompt? This is the core of what the skill does behind the scenes.

prompt structure.md
Role

You are a MECE Problem Structuring Coach trained on the McKinsey method and the work of Barbara Minto.

Phase 1 – SCR

Reframe the problem as a Situation, Complication, and Resolution question. The resolution question will be the root of the Issue Tree.

Phase 2 – Decomposition

Break down the root cause into 2 to 5 sub-questions. Choose the appropriate MECE structure: algebraic, process-based, stakeholder, segment, 7S, or internal x external.

Phase 3 – Hypothesis per branch

Each branch has a falsifiable statement with impact (high/medium/low), required evidence, and owner.

Phase 4 – Priority and action

Test MECE explicitly. Mark 80/20 branches. End with 1 concrete action of maximum 1 working day.

MECE stands for Mutually Exclusive, Collectively Exhaustive. It was introduced by Barbara Minto at McKinsey in the 1960s. It works because it prevents two very common mistakes: double work (overlap between branches) and blind spots (missing branches). With MECE, you can be sure that you cover everything without double-analysing.

How does this differ from the Pyramid Principle or SCQA?

The Pyramid Principle (also by Minto) is how you communicate your answer: top-down, governing thought, supported by arguments. SCQA is a narrative structure for the opening: situation, complication, question, answer. MECE is underneath that: how you break down the problem itself before formulating an answer. They reinforce each other.
